(2013-03-10 13:30)fecklesslout Wrote:  My question relates to the custom home menu buttons. I'm running Eden on Windows 7. I've got two custom buttons - Family Films and Anime. I've added both directories to my Favourites. Family Films loads up fine - all of the movies show up and it all works great. Anime, on the otherhand, comes up with a blank list.

to troubleshoot:
1) enable debuglogging (settings > system > debugging)
2) restart xbmc
3) click the Family Films button
4) go back to home and click the Anime button
5) post the logfile to xbmclogs.com and paste the url here

there's one known issue with favourites in xbmc eden
and it might be causing your issue, but i need a debug log to know for sure.

yup, that's 'the unfixable bug'.
the eden version of T! in combination with the eden version of the favourites script
can't properly handle favourites starting with a drive letter (eg. C:\..).

this has been fixed in the frodo version.
